Iranian police seize smuggled sexual stimulant medicine

Iran Materials 21 August 2013 17:29 (UTC +04:00)

Azerbaijan, Baku, Aug. 21 / Trend, N. Umid

Iran police have seized some $3.227 million worth of smuggled medicine into country during first four months of the current solar year (which started on March 21), commander of Police Department for Campaign against Smuggling of Goods and Foreign Currency, Fathollah Zamanian said, Mehr news agency reported.

He also went on to note that, seized medicines mainly include abortion, sexual stimulant (aphrodisiac) and ergogenic drugs.

Some 390 medicine smugglers were arrested during first four months of the current solar year, Zamanian said.

Iran has imported 16,000 tons of drugs worth $1.468 billion, during the last solar year (which ended on March 21).

Drug imports ranked tenth on Iran's last year imported goods list.

During the first month of the current solar year, drug imports reached $34.3 million. Iran currently is the world's biggest drug importer.

The decrease in the medicine imports took place, while there was no decrease at the domestic market.
